Obituary for Harold Winford (Winnie) Spangler, Jr. Harold Winford (Winnie) Spangler, Jr.
Former C&O Signalman Was U. S. Army, National Guard Veteran

Harold Winford (Winnie) Spangler, Jr., age 70, of 521 Tremont Street, Clifton Forge, Virginia died Monday, January 27, 2020 at his residence.

He was born November 17, 1949 in Clifton Forge to the late Harold Winford Spangler, Sr. and Elise May Morris Ayers.

He was a signalman for Chesapeake and Ohio Railroad, and served in the United States Army and National Guard. He was a member of the Burnside-Carpenter Post 4299 Veterans of Foreign Wars of Clifton Forge and the VFW Motorcycle Club.

In addition to his parents, he was preceded in death by his wife, Darlene Humphries, and his stepfather, Calvin Ayers.

He is survived a daughter, Amber Spangler and a son, Sherman Spangler and wife, Michaela, both of Clifton Forge; six grandchildren, Trevor Bunch, Deston Spangler, Gracie Spangler, Isabella Spangler, Brendon Spangler, and Amaura Spangler; and special family friends, Alex Saunders, Michael Harris, and Stan Nicely, Jr.

A funeral service will be held on Thursday, January 30, 2020 at 2:00 p.m. in the chapel of Nicely Funeral Home, Clifton Forge, with Reverend Barry Daniel, Jr. officiating. Interment will follow in Mountain View Cemetery, Clifton Forge. Military rites will be conducted by members of the Burnside-Carpenter Post 4299 VFW.

The family will receive friends on Wednesday evening from 6:00 - 8:00 p.m. at Nicely Funeral Home.
